What other rankings don't show you

Most rating sites report "33% proficient" for Visual and Performing Arts at Legacy High School C and stop there. Here's what that number hides:

13.5% of students exceeded standard while 19.6% merely met it. That exceeded rate is near the state average of 15.5%. That's 5.3 points below the Los Angeles Unified district average of 18.8%. Nearby schools (within ~3 miles) average 13.2% exceeded — about the same. The gap between "met" and "exceeded" is the difference between a school that clears the bar and one that raises it.

The graduation rate is 91.2% — above the state target. 56.6% of students complete A-G requirements for UC/CSU eligibility — a strong college readiness signal. 54.3% of graduates go on to college within a year.

Chronic absenteeism is 37.1%, above the state average of 34.0%.
